Output 51c43a4ed95c3953fc734299a6c2805b63a3e4f11eb3967cae09a8b3cc33360b:0

value
600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 05156661f7886dcd8325690d0fa3b1040bd8732a OP_EQUALVERIFY OP_CHECKSIG
address
1Tt1rSsjTVVnhb2FPrYNvjpjfVbacnVBr
transaction
51c43a4ed95c3953fc734299a6c2805b63a3e4f11eb3967cae09a8b3cc33360b
confirmations
389572
spent
true